Manufacturing and cutting of prisms by hand

Heating

1. Large glass rods are heated in an oven until they are soft enough to be pressed into prisms.
Press

2. The glass rod is inserted between the moulds in the manual press. When the press is opened again the glass has taken the shape of a raw prism.
Cooling

3. Still hot, the newly pressed prism is lifted of the press and put in sand to slowly cool of.

Cutting

4. The left over glass is cut from the cool prism.

The edges of the prisms are cut by hand as well as the facets of the prisms.

Quality control and final cut

5. After a quality control, the facets are polished into their definitive appearance.
Polishing

6. Finally, all of the prisms go through the final quality control where every facet is checked, first after cutting, and then again after polishing.
